body {
    	margin: 0px;
	background-image: url("../pics/back02.jpg");
            
	background-repeat: repeat-y;

	background-color: #000000;
        overflow: scroll;
        	font-family: "Courier New", Courier, mono;
                font-size: 0.8em;

}
#boxzentriert {
	position:absolute;
	top:0px;
	left:0px;
	width:600px;
	height: 100%;
	margin-left:0;
	margin-top:0;
	overflow: visible;
}
#boxscroll {
	position:absolute;
	top:120px;
	left:605px;
	width:140px;
	height:22px;
	margin-left:0;
	margin-top:0;
	overflow: hidden;
	z-index: 1;
}
#boxaddtab {
	position:absolute;
	top:106px;
	left:315px;
	width:440px;
	height:32px;
	margin-left:0;
	margin-top:0;
	overflow: hidden;
	z-index: 1;
}
#boxadditional {
	position:absolute;
	top:122px;
	left:358px;
	width:96px;
	height:22px;
	margin-left:0;
	margin-top:0;
	overflow: hidden;
}
#boxpdf {
	position:absolute;
	top:108px;
	left:317px;
	width:30px;
	height:32px;
	margin-left:0;
	margin-top:0;
	overflow: hidden;
	z-index: 1;
}
#boxprintlogo {
	position:absolute;
	top:114px;
	left:453px;
	width:22px;
	height:22px;
	margin-left:0;
	margin-top:0;
	overflow: hidden;
	z-index: 1;
}
#boxprint {
	position:absolute;
	top:120px;
	left:479px;
	width:114px;
	height:22px;
	margin-left:0;
	margin-top:0;
	overflow: hidden;
}
#boxrahmen {
	position:absolute;
	top:150px;
	left:190px;
	width:600px;
	height: 100%;
	margin-left:0;
	margin-top:0;
	overflow: visible;
}
#boxlogo {
	position:absolute;
	top:-2px;
	left:51px;
	width:207px;
	height:150px;
	margin-left:0;
	margin-top:0;
        background-image:  url(pics/logo.jpg);
}

#boxnavilinks {
	position:absolute;
	top:150px;
	left:10px;
	width:150px;
	height:500px;
	margin-left:0;
	margin-top:0;
        color: red;
}


#boxnavilinks h2{
font-size: 14px;
color: black;
}

#boxnavilinks ul {
color: black;
}

#boxnavilinks ul {
    list-style-type: none;
color: black;
}

#boxnavilinks li a {
color: red;
margin-left: -35px;
font-size: 11px;
}

#boxnavilinks li a:hover {
color: black;

}

.normaltextgr5 {
	font-family: "Courier New", Courier, mono;
	font-size: 12px;
	color: #ffffff;
}
.normaltextgr2 {

	font-family: "Courier New", Courier, mono;
	font-size: 18px;
	color: #ffffff;
}
.navigation a:link {
	font-family: "Courier New", Courier, mono;
	font-size: 11px;
	color: #000000;
	line-height: 14px;
	text-decoration: none;
	}
	.navigation a:visited {
	font-family: "Courier New", Courier, mono;
	font-size: 11px;
	color: #000000;
	line-height: 14px;
	text-decoration: none;
	}
.navigation a:hover {
	font-family: "Courier New", Courier, mono;
	font-size: 11px;
	color: #E12420;
	text-decoration: underline;
	line-height: 14px;

	}

.navigation a:active {
	font-family: "Courier New", Courier, mono;
	font-size: 11px;
	color: #E12420;
	line-height: 14px;
	text-decoration: none;
	}

.navigationinvers a:link { 
	font-family: "Courier New", Courier, mono;
	font-size: 12px;
	color: #ffffff;
	text-decoration: underline;
	}
.navigationinvers a:hover { 
	font-family: "Courier New", Courier, mono;
	font-size: 12px;
	color: #E12420;
	text-decoration: underline;
	}
.navigationinvers a:visited { 
	font-family: "Courier New", Courier, mono;
	font-size: 12px;
	color: #ffffff;
	text-decoration: underline;
	}

.navigationinvers a:active { 
	font-family: "Courier New", Courier, mono;
	font-size: 12px;
	color: #E12420;
	text-decoration: underline;
	}.normaltextgr5rotkursiv {
	font-family: "Courier New", Courier, mono;
	font-size: 11px;
	color: #E12420;
	font-style: italic;
}
.normalfettgr5 {
	font-family: "Courier New", Courier, mono;
	font-size: 12px;
	color: #ffffff;
	font-weight: bolder;
	text-decoration: underline;
}
.normaltextgr5kursiv {
	font-family: "Courier New", Courier, mono;
	font-size: 12px;
	color: #ffffff;
	font-style: italic;
}
.normaltextgr5blau {

	font-family: "Courier New", Courier, mono;
	font-size: 12px;
	color: #0000FF;
}
.naviheadline {
	font-family: "Courier New", Courier, mono;
	font-size: 14px;
	color: #E12420;
	font-style: normal;
	font-weight: bold;
	text-decoration: none;
}
.Stil1 {
    color: #FFFFFF
}

.Stil2 {
    font-size: 12px
}

.Stil3 { 
    font-size: 16px
}

#Layer1 {
    position: absolute; 
    width: 294px; 
    height: 400px; 
    z-index:2; 
    left: 464px; 
    top: 218px;
}

.entree {
    position: relative;
    margin-left: 375px;
    margin-top: 0px;
     width: 5000px;
     height: 200px;

}

.content {
        position: relative;
    margin-left: 300px;
    margin-top: 165px;
    width: 600px;
    color: white;

}

.bild {
    float: left;
    margin-right: 20px;
}

.content a:link,
.normaltextgr5rotkursiv a:link,
.entree a:link {
	color: white;
	text-decoration: underline;
        border: none;
}
.content a:visited,
.normaltextgr5rotkursiv a:visited,
.entree a:visited {
	color: white;
	text-decoration: underline;
}
.content a:hover,
.normaltextgr5rotkursiv a:hover,
.entree a:hover {
	color: #FF0000;
	text-decoration: none;
}
.content a:active,
.normaltextgr5rotkursiv a:active,
.entree a:active {
	color: #FF0000;
}

h1 {
    color: white;
}


#overlay{ background-image: url(pics/overlay.png); }

* html #overlay{
	background-color: #000;
	back\ground-color: transparent;
	background-image: url(blank.gif);
	fil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src="pics/overlay.png", sizingMethod="scale");
	}

